What collector plates are worth the most?

What collector plates are worth the most?

Antique Trader notes that collector plates from the 1920s are some of the most valuable but only if they are in perfect condition. According to Terry Kovel, plates made after 1980 usually have no monetary value at all. Most collector plates from major manufacturers feature very detailed back stamps.

How do I know if my dishes are worth anything?

Look for a back stamp or marker stamp.
This is the easiest way to identify the manufacturer of your dinnerware, although in many cases the stamps may have faded or become illegible. Once you know the manufacturer, you can look up the approximate value of the piece online.

What are Norman Rockwell collector plates worth?

Norman Rockwell collector plates are only worth about $10.
According to Antique Trader, Norman Rockwell plates once valued at $50 to $75 sell for $10 a plate.

Are Thomas Kinkade plates worth anything?

Most plates, even when accompanied by their box and all the literature that came with them, sell for a few dollars, i.e., between $1 and $4, when offered for sale at auction.

How do I know if my china is worth money?

Fine china is not a technical term – it simply means good quality china. If the china is modern or hard-paste, then it’s not usually worth much unless it’s rare or collectible. If your china is bone china and very old or rare, then it may be worth a fortune!

What is the most expensive Norman Rockwell painting?

Saying Grace
Stuart, Sr. – the artist’s longtime friend and art editor at “The Saturday Evening Post” – all sold for a stunning total of $59,663,000 at Sotheby’s New York, Dec. 4, 2013. The group was led by Rockwell’s masterpiece “Saying Grace,” which set a new auction record for an American painting at $46,085,000.

What is the most sought after antique?

5 World’s Most Valuable Antiques and Collectibles of All Time

  1. Pinner Qing Dynasty Vase – $80.2 million. Source.
  2. Ru Guanyao Brush Washer Bowl – $37.68 million. Source.
  3. Record-Breaking Persian Rug – $33.76 million.
  4. Leonardo da Vinci’s Codex Leicester – $30.8 million.
  5. Patek Philippe Supercomplication Pocket Watch – $24 million.
